NEW JERSEY (PIX11) – It’s debate night in New Jersey as the candidates for lieutenant governor go head-to-head in a live debate on PIX11.

The leading candidates for New Jersey governor have chosen their seconds-in-command. Now, it’s time for the voters to decide.

Republican nominee Jack Ciattarelli has chosen Morris County Sheriff James Gannon as his running mate. Democratic nominee Mikie Sherrill has chosen Dale Caldwell, president of Centenary University.

The two will go head-to-head Tuesday night at a debate hosted by PIX11 News and Kean University.

The live, 60-minute debate, moderated by PIX11’s Dan Mannarino and Henry Rossoff, starts at 7 p.m. and airs across multiple platforms, including PIX11, PIX11+ and PIX11.com.
